Kenworth T370 Offers Heavier Front Axles
Kenworth will now offer heavier front axles for its T370 Class 7 model. The 18,000- and 20,000-pound axles are available with the PACCAR PX-9 engine rated up to 350 horsepower and 1,150 pound-feet of torque. Terex Acquires Assets of DUECO
Terex Corp. has acquired substantially all of the assets of DUECO Inc. The acquisition brings DUECO’s sales and service operations, which have responsibility for Terex utilities products in 17 states, into the Utilities and Services business units of Terex Corp. Buyers Products’ Waterproof Winches
Buyers Products has introduced new waterproof, electric winches. Available in two sizes – 9,500-pound and 12,000-pound – the new commercial-grade electric line pull winches are ideal for utility, government and contractor fleet vehicles.
